We just released Mastodon 4.3.1!

It contains some bug fixes and a few small features, like (optional) grouping of follow notifications and improvements the fediverse:creator setup instructions.

Upgrading requires re-compiling frontend assets (if not using Docker), instructions are in the release notes : https://github.com/mastodon/mastodon/releases/tag/v4.3.1

This past quarter, live streaming viewership reached 8.5 billion hours watched, a 12% year-over-year increase— biggest jump since the pandemic began

I wrote about how live streaming is becoming a bigger part of our media diet and how ppl crave participatory live media https://www.usermag.co/p/you-should-pay-attention-to-kai-cenat

At the creator level, the live streaming market is also becoming more decentralized. The top 5% of streamers now account for 86% of total hours watched, which is notably down from 98% in 2019.

As viewers explore niche communities and new voices, the live streaming creator world is becoming more nichified (something that happened on YouTube too as it grew).
